Icebox Berry Cake

A no-bake summer dessert made with graham crackers, vanilla pudding, cream cheese, whipped topping, and fresh strawberries and blueberries. After chilling overnight, the layers soften into a cool, creamy cake that can be sliced into squares.

Ingredients

  • 14 oz Graham crackers
  • 8 oz Cream cheese (Softened)
  • 2 boxes Instant vanilla pudding mix (Two 3.4-ounce boxes)
  • 2.5 cups Whole milk
  • 16 oz Cool Whip whipped topping (Fold 12 ounces into the pudding mixture; use the remaining 4 ounces for the bottom layer)
  • 16 oz Strawberries (Sliced)
  • 1.5 cups Blueberries

Steps

  1. 1

    Soften the cream cheese before beginning. Prepare a 9 x 13-inch baking dish and have the graham crackers and sliced berries ready for layering.

  2. 2

    In a large bowl, beat the softened cream cheese together with the two boxes of instant vanilla pudding mix until combined and smooth.

  3. 3

    Slowly beat the whole milk into the cream cheese and pudding mixture. Continue mixing until the mixture is smooth and thickened.

  4. 4

    Fold 12 ounces of the Cool Whip into the pudding mixture until evenly incorporated, taking care not to deflate the whipped topping excessively.

  5. 5

    Spread the remaining Cool Whip in an even layer across the bottom of the 9 x 13-inch baking dish.

  6. 6

    Arrange a layer of graham crackers over the Cool Whip, covering as much of the bottom as possible. Break crackers as needed to fill gaps.

  7. 7

    Spread one-third of the pudding mixture evenly over the graham crackers.

  8. 8

    Scatter one-quarter of the sliced strawberries and blueberries over the pudding layer.

  9. 9

    Repeat the graham-cracker, one-third-pudding, and one-quarter-berries layering sequence two more times. Finish with berries on top, as directed in the source.

  10. 10

    Cover the dish and refrigerate overnight, allowing the graham crackers to soften and the layers to set.

  11. 11

    Slice the chilled cake into squares and serve cold.

Notes

The source says to use 12 ounces of Cool Whip in the pudding mixture and also calls for a layer of Cool Whip on the bottom, so the remaining 4 ounces are allocated to the bottom layer. The berry instruction says to use one-quarter of the berries in each repeated layer; reserve enough berries to finish the top. Keep refrigerated.
